Abstract:
The article analyzes the trends in social assistance in Brazil in this context of covid-19, which favors cash transfer programs with values far below social needs, which aggravate the condition of structural social inequality, deepened by ultraneoliberalism and neo-fascism in Brazil. This perverse, morbid and toxic combination took us to the place that we occupy today in the pandemic, but it is a fact that such a project already finds a country torn apart by the economic and social crisis.
